Green Energy

Green Energy is an energy that is generated from natural resources such as Water, Wind, Waves, Sunlight, Volcanic Hot Spots, etc. Green energy is produced from renewable resources and also non polluting in nature.

Green Energy is those that use resources that are constantly being replenished such as Hydro Power, Wind Power, or Solar Energy.

Types of Green Energy

Hydropower

The power is generated from turbines installed in Dams. The force of the flowing water is utilized to run the turbines and in turn, it produces electricity.

Solar

Solar energy is the most common green energy. It utilizes the Sunlight and Solar PV cells to generate electricity. Solar is widely considered as the energy of the future.

Wind Power

Wind energy is the stellar renewable source of power. The moving wind is utilized to produce electricity and Wind Power Mills.

Geothermal

The hotspots in regions of volcano, is used to generate electricity by using natural hotwater from the ground.

Green Energy and its benefits

Green energy is renewable. It means it is produces little or no environmental impact. Also it does not release greenhouse gases into the atmosphere that contributes to global warming.
